The Role

Reporting into a Senior Quantity Surveyor or Commercial Manager, you will be responsible for managing the commercial aspects of your allocated project(s) from procurement through to final account.

Key responsibilities include:

Subcontract procurement and package management

Contract administration (NEC predominantly, with some JCT exposure)

Managing valuations, variations and change control

Producing cost reports, forecasts and CVRs

Supporting subcontractor negotiations and final accounts

Working closely with operational teams to monitor cost and risk

You will be given genuine responsibility while operating within a strong commercial framework.

About You

Experience working as a Quantity Surveyor within civil engineering, groundworks or RC frame environments

Working knowledge of NEC contracts

Strong commercial awareness and negotiation capability

Confident managing subcontractor accounts and reporting

Degree qualified (Quantity Surveying or similar) preferred
